Tax Associate Manager – ICEG (Italy, Central Europe, Greece)

We are looking for a positive and adaptable person with strong communication skills (English and Italian) and solid organizational abilities. Independent and proactive, comfortable working in a dynamic and international environment, and able to engage effectively with both management and non‑tax functions.

Responsibilities

  • Support the Area Tax Lead in providing advice for the efficient implementation of client engagements, regional tax planning opportunities and M&A projects, and assist with the supervision of tax compliance across multiple countries (Italy, Poland, Greece, Romania, Czech Republic, Slovakia, Bulgaria, Croatia, Hungary and Cyprus).
  • Interact frequently with regional management, senior finance and legal personnel, treasury, controllership, and other members of the Accenture Global Tax Group worldwide.
  • Conduct routine consultation, tax return support, and cross‑border structuring.
  • Analyze potential tax implications for transactions and business projects in collaboration with clients, internal functions and external advisors.
  • Ensure compliance with local and international tax laws, monitor legislative changes, and support annual statutory audits for material tax items.
  • Contribute to the development of tax planning proposals and coordinate with GTG Leads for implementation.
  • Communicate complex tax matters to non‑tax stakeholders and leadership.
  • Collaborate with other tax groups to harmonise in‑country tax planning, M&A projects and post‑acquisition integration of newly acquired entities.
  • Support the management of tax audits and controversies, coordinating external advisers with the Area Tax Lead and Regional Tax Director.
  • Assist with income tax returns, tax accounting, forecasting and reporting activities.

Qualifications

  • Recognised tax qualification with a minimum of 5 years’ experience; previous experience in a Big 4 international tax department or equivalent is appreciated.
  • Good knowledge and understanding of international tax principles and local tax regulations in the ICEG region.
  • Fluency in English and Italian, spoken and written; other European languages are a plus.
  • Ability to work as part of a team and manage multiple projects in an international context.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ft applications.
  • University degree.
